Income deemed to accrue or arise in India - Fee for Technical Services (FTS)/ Fee for Included Services (FIS) - the services provided by the assessee under the marketing support service agreement are neither in the nature of technical or consultancy services under Article 12(4) of India – USA Tax Treaty. Even, assuming that it is in the nature of consultancy services, however, the ‘make available’ condition provided under Article 12(4)(b) of the Tax Treaty is not satisfied. - AT
